Transaction 13d5614056948c314a7e9632bc377a57066b4ed516798d60fd4335260a658b89

2 Input
2 Outputs
  • 13d5614056948c314a7e9632bc377a57066b4ed516798d60fd4335260a658b89:0
  • value  330207970
    address  1DWaUpYFuBUCsJ2u7wPf8jMKdaTofNEhJr
  • 13d5614056948c314a7e9632bc377a57066b4ed516798d60fd4335260a658b89:1
  • value  200000000
    address  3HEE1GPUJ1Y51ZXtsttvQrUaRJoVtLFuy7